Can you please split this into a patch that adds the uclass and one
that plumbs it into board_r.c?

Also can you add a patch with a sandbox timer driver and a test (in
test/dm) for the timer?

> +/*
> + * Implement a Timer uclass to work with lib/time.c. The timer is usually
> + * a 32 bits free-running up counter. The get_clock() method is used to get
> + * the input clock frequency of the timer. The get_count() method is used
> + * get the current 32 bits count value. If the hardware is counting down,
> + * the value should be inversed inside the method. There may be no real
> + * tick, and no timer interrupt.
> + */

> +int timer_get_clock(struct udevice *dev, unsigned long *freq)

Probably timer_get_rate() is better - we yes it has a clock but it is
the clock rate that we are returning.

Isn't the frequency always the same for a given timer? I think this
should be stored in the uclass private data. The timer could do this
in its probe function. Then this function can just return that value
rather than needing a driver method:

unsigned long timer_get_rate(struct udevice *dev)
{
   struct uc_priv *priv = dev_get_uclass_pric(dev);

   return priv->clock_rate;
}
